The trip from Sterling Heights to Orlando covers roughly 1,200 miles. Driving via I-75 S is the most direct route, taking about 18 hours. Flying from Detroit Metropolitan Airport (DTW) to Orlando International (MCO) takes about 2.5 hours. Orlando is a major tourist hub, famous for its theme parks.
